2. Scope of service

EventReplay provides a post-event processing service that includes: video and slide synchronisation, transcript generation, multilingual AI translation, per-session chatbot creation and content publishing on a dedicated platform. The service covers post-event replay only — EventReplay does not provide live-streaming services.

5. Intellectual property

All content provided by the Organizer (video, audio, slides) remains the exclusive property of the Organizer. EventReplay acquires a limited, non-exclusive and revocable licence to use such content, solely as necessary for the provision of the service (processing, hosting, distribution to authorised participants).

The EventReplay platform, its code, design and AI features remain the exclusive property of EventReplay.

6. Participant access

Access to replay content is provided via a magic link sent to the participant's email address. Each participant may have a maximum of 2 simultaneous active sessions. The link is personal and non-transferable. The Organizer is responsible for the accuracy of the participant list.

7. Hosting duration

Content remains available on the platform for the duration agreed in the contract (6, 12 or 24 months). Upon expiry of the hosting period, content enters archive mode (read-only, without active chatbot). The Organizer may request a hosting renewal or a download of their content before the expiry date.
